Group of three motorcyclists flee from police
A group of motorcyclists fled from Birmingham police on Saturday, December 9, after allegedly excessively speeding down Woodward Avenue at Bowers.
Birmingham police indicated that a patrol officer heard a radio report around 10 p.m. from a Royal Oak police officer stating a group of motorcyclists was speeding at more than 100 miles per hour northbound on Woodward.
The Birmingham office spotted the group of three speeding up Woodward at Lincoln, eventually catching up to them at a red light on Woodward at Bowers. Reportedly, the drivers fled from the officer once the light turned green, but the license plate information was recorded.
An investigation is ongoing.
